Angelozzi
San Gimignano · Province of Siena · Toscana
Angelozzi operates in San Gimignano, the medieval town in the Sienese area where soils of volcanic origin and a unique microclimate define the contours of an unrepeatable white wine. The winery focuses on Vernaccia di San Gimignano DOCG, the only Tuscan white to boast this denomination: a savory and mineral wine obtained from the indigenous Vernaccia grape, with an alcohol content not less than 11.5%. The calcareous-rich soil and altitude impart precision to each harvest, yielding a taut and defined profile that distinguishes this corner of Tuscany from the more famous surrounding red denominations. By concentrating on a single wine, Angelozzi interprets one of the region's most clearly delimited terroirs, where the geography itself sets the boundaries of what the glass can contain. The result is a white that foregoes exuberance to prioritize linearity and freshness, a measure of a place that has made its flagship grape variety an identifying characteristic.
